Registrations are now open for this year’s National General Assembly of Local Government (NGA).

This year, the NGA celebrates 25 years! Over the past quarter century, the NGA has provided a platform for local government to address national issues and lobby the federal government on critical issues facing our sector.

The theme for the 2019 NGA is ‘Future Focused’; this theme acknowledges that the assembly will be held after a federal election and that, as a sector, our collective voice will need to be heard by the incoming government to deliver on collaboration for our communities.

The theme also considers what councils can do today to get ready for the challenges, opportunities and changes that lie ahead. Technology has taken off, demographics are changing, and artificial intelligence and self-driving cars are just around the corner. These changes will be compounded by climate change and exacerbated by increasing community expectations about the level and types of services and infrastructure provided by councils.
